The American Red Cross is currently seeking a Development Data Coordinator to support the Central Appalachian Region. This is a hybrid position that can be in any of the following areas: Ashland, KY, Beckley, WV, Charleston, WV, Huntington, WV, Morgantown, WV, Parkersburg, WV, Hagerstown, MD, Winchester, VA. The Development Data Coordinator supports funding growth development through data analysis, systems training, reporting, data hygiene, and implementation of gift processing procedures. Coordinate with volunteers who perform data entry to support the development team. Utilize systems to support fundraising leadership and field fundraisers. Provide support, development, and/or leadership guidance to all volunteers. This position is not eligible for relocation assistance. Responsibilities • Identify needed adjustments and/or linking requests to support accuracy of revenue and fundraiser credit per the guidelines. Provide data and reports to assist leadership in operational reviews, monitoring activity and performance, and other initiatives as directed. • Coordinate gift processing to include cross-functional collaboration to ensure accurate execution of check processing and bundling procedures are followed and understood. • Coordinate data hygiene updates to ensure quality data by creating new accounts, requesting account merges, and making other needed updates. Support portfolio updates as defined by leadership by transferring accounts/contacts to the appropriate relationship manager, inactivating and adding new accounts, and ensuring portfolios are reflected for each role. Monitor upcoming and past due solicitations and gifts and share information to ensure data is updated appropriately. • Assist with onboarding of new fundraisers and serve as a systems trainer for new hires and volunteers. Provide ongoing user training and education on new functionality and/or changes in the system. • May serve as the liaison to key national contacts for data systems, gift processing and research as needed. Support tracking large budgeted monthly gifts, as reflected in the revenue budget to support forecasting. • Support volunteers who perform data entry and data-related projects for development team.
